บทคัดย่อ
Centella asiatica is one of the medicinal herbs that has been used extensively by Ayurvedic Pharmacoeia to alleviate high blood pressure. Therefore, use of this plant containing antihypertensive flavonoids (e.g. rutin, quercetin, and catechin) appeared a natural alternative for antihypertensive drugs replacement. Hence, the aims of the present study were to investigate the effects of Centella asiaticaextract and quercetin on rat aortic ring vasorelaxation activity in vitro and arterial blood pressure in male Wistar rats in vivo. This study consisted of 3 main experiments:Experiment 1 investigated the effects of Centella asiatica extract to elucidate the underlying mechanisms on isolated rat aortic rings using organ bath system. The results showed that Centella asiaticaextract had a yield of 8.04%. Total phenolic content was 87.47 ? 1.74 mg gallic acid/g dry extract. Centella asiatica extract and quercetin has a potential ability to regulate vascular tone. Vasorelaxation induced by Centella asiatica extract and quercetin were found to be endothelium-independent and unrelated to nitric oxide (NO). Opening of potassium (K+) channel and L-type calcium (Ca2+) channels was involved in the relaxation process of vascular smooth muscle. Experiment 2 investigated the acute effects of Centella asiatica extract on arterial blood pressure, heart rate, and respiratory rate of anaesthetized normotensive and NG-nitro-L-arginine methyl ester (L-NAME) induced hypertensive rats. The results showed blood pressure lowering effects of intragastric administration of Centella asiatica extract and quercetin in L-NAME induced hypertensive rats. Hypertensive effects of Centella asiatica extract and quercetin were found in normotensive rats. Centella asiatica extract and quercetin did not alter heart rate and respiratory rate in both groups.Experiment 3 investigated the sub-chronic effects of Centella asiatica extract and quercetin on systolic blood pressure (SBP) of normotensive and L-NAME induced hypertensive rats by the tail cuff method. The results showed that Centella asiatica extract and quercetin possessed antihypertensive effects on L-NAME induced hypertensive rats, but had no effect on normotensive rats.In conclusion, the present findings suggest that Centella asiatica extract and its bioactive compound quercetin exhibit antihypertensive effects and support traditional use of this plant in human cardiovascular diseases.
